People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ding CF24 2NH has a slightly higher male population, with 50.7%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around CF24 2NH,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 60.7%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a lower perc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(65.9%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either an older population or social deprivation in the area.

Safety

Is Railway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Railway Street was 38.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 68.1% lower than the Splott average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Railway Street has the 7th lowest crime rate of 42 local areas in Splott and the 334th lowest crime rate of 1,028 local areas in Cardiff .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 21.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-8.2%.
